  • Patent number: 4767824
    Abstract: This invention relates to a process for polymerizing acrylic monomers and possibly non-acrylic co-monomers by means of polymerization-initiating agents of the formula:R--M (I)in which M represents a metal selected among the alkaline and alkaline-earth metals and R represents an alkyl radical, which may have a straight or branched chain and contains 2 to 6 carbon atoms, or an aryl radical.The polymerization or copolymerization is effected in the presence of an additive consisting of a salt of an alkaline or alkaline-earth metal and of a mineral acid, such as lithium chloride.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: November 5, 1985
    Date of Patent: August 30, 1988
    Assignee: Compagnie Internationale de Participation
    Inventors: Trazollah Ouhadi, Rosalia Forte, Robert E. Jerome, Roger M. Fayt, Philippe J. Teyssie
